Job Description and Duties

The Staff Services Manager I will be directed by the Staff Services Manager II- Personnel Officer in the Human Resources Department. The incumbent will be responsible for the following duties but not limited to:

  • Responsible for the supervision of the Return to Work section in carrying out the full range of functions including but not limited to claims management, return to work, limited duty, pregnancy accommodations, fitness for duty, reasonable suspicion drug testing, annual health reviews and pre-employment physicals.
  • Make recommendations to hospital management regarding hospital policies and procedures to ensure compliance with various laws, rules and regulations.
  • Work closely with contracted medical provider to streamline the pre-employment physical process.  M onitor progress, services and costs.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S: Either I One year of experience in the California state service performing analytical staff duties of a class with a level of responsibility not less than that of Associate Governmental Program Analyst. (Applicants who have completed six months of service performing the duties as specified above will be admitted to the examination, but they must satisfactorily complete one year of this experience before they can be eligible for appointment.) Or II Experience: Three years of increasingly responsible management, personnel, fiscal, planning, program evaluation, or related analytical experience beyond the trainee level which shall have included the preparation of reports and the presentation of recommendations to management, at least one year of which must have been in a full journeyperson technical capacity. (Experience in the California state service applied toward this requirement must include one year performing the duties of a class with a level of responsibility not less than that of Associate Governmental Program Analyst.) (In appraising experience more weight will be given to the breadth of pertinent experience and the evidence of the candidate's ability to accept and fulfill increasing responsibilities than to the length of the experience.) AND Education: Equivalent to graduation from college. (Additional qualifying experience may be substituted for the required education on a year-for-year basis.)
